Returns a numerical value indicating the time, including seconds, of the bar at which a text object with the specified ID number has been placed; returns a value of -2 if the specified object ID number is invalid.
The time is indicated in the 24-hour HHmmss format, where 130000 = 1:00:00 PM.
Usage
Text_GetTime_s(ObjectID)
Where:
- ObjectID - a numerical expression specifying the object ID number.
Notes
- An object-specific ID number is returned by Text_New_s when the text object is created.
- Use Text_GetTime to get the time of a text object with minute precision.
Example
Assign a value, indicating the time of the bar at which a text object with the ID number of 3 has been placed, to Value1 variable:
Value1 = Text_GetTime_s(3);
